Reasons For Refusal
Application Ref No: 03/00844/B
- Number 50 Patrick Street is within the Peel Conservation Area, whilst the original windows have been lost, the Planning Committee considers that the most appropriate window style for the property would be vertical sliding sash. The proposed casement window is considered to be out of character with the dwelling and would harm the character and appearance of the Conservation Area.
- The proposed door whilst panelled, would detract from the character and appearance of the dwelling by reason of its colour and side panel.
NOTE Grant assistance of up to $50 \%$ is available for replacement windows and doors in an appropriate design. Further advice is available from the Conservation Section.
